Ghana edge Nigeria to win five-goal thriller
Ghana's U-20 team put on a show to edge rivals,
Nigeria 3-2 in their opening Group A match at the
8-Nation International tournament in South
Africa.

The Black Satellites now need a win from their
next match to the semi-finals.

Goals from Baba Abdul Rahman, Frank Sarfo Gyamfi
and Benjamin Fadi helped the Black Satellites
secure victory on Friday at the Athlone Stadium.

Ghana are second on the standings though level on
points with Argentina, three apiece after the
South American nation beat South Africa 3-1 in the
other group match.

The Flying Eagles, against the run of play took
the lead through Uche Agbo, who headed home after
47 minutes.

However, Ghana drew level almost immediately when
left-back Baba Rahman scored with a shot from
outside the box.

Nigeria jumped into the lead again when Aminu Umar
bundled the ball into the empty goal after a
scramble in the Ghana box in the 61st minute.

It took Black Satellites 19 minutes after falling
back to draw level. Sarfo Gyamfi smashed home from
a free kick that sailed beyond goalkeeper Samuel
Okani.

And with four minutes remaining, substitute Fadi,
was on hand to tap-in the match winner.

The win will boost coach Orlando Wellington's side
ahead of their meeting against the hosts, Amajita
at the Cape Town Stadium on Sunday before
finishing up the group campaign against
Argentina.

According to the tournament rules, the top two
teams in each group, qualify for the last four
stage.

Ghana line up
Felix Annan, Seidu Salifu, Baba Abdul Rahman,
Lawrence Lartey, Daniel Amartey, Mumuni
Abubakar/Isaac Sackey, Frank Sarfo Gyamfi, Prince
Baffoe/Moro Ibrahim, Jacob Asiedu, Fatau Safiu,
Abdul Basit/Benjamin Fadi.
